Description

Narrow blue-green leaves followed by a very short conical spike of deep blue flowers in February. These persist until late April, gradually expanding as the spike extends, so that after flowering has finished the spike may be some 20 cm tall. Each 1 cm methyl-violet bloom has a sky blue ovary, the whole being held away from the main stem by a 3 cm stalk.

Good outside in a well drained sunny spot selected with due attention to its 20-25 cm height, but excellent under glass also where you can enjoy earlier flowers and the captive scent.

Well drained loam-based soil or compost.
